Biography
My research focuses on the biodiscovery of fungi and the fungus-like protists, slime molds (myxomycetes), in under-explored microhabitats in tropical ecosystems (e.g., canopy soil, wetlands, geographically isolated islands, etc) through a polyphasic approach of morphocultural, physiological and genomics/phylogenetic (DNA barcoding) methods and the understanding of their biodiversity, ecological patterns and interactions through culture-dependent and culture-independent approaches in response to changing landscapes brought about by man-made activities (habitat fragmentation, urbanization) and natural hazards (typhoons, volcanic activities). I conduct research on the bioactivities and natural products of fungi for drug discovery and novel agro-chemicals. My interest on science education and promotion led to the publication of comic books on fungi for kids, on microbiology education and ethnomycology.
